The Public Accountability Index (iPC), developed by the Office of the Comptroller General of the State of Rio Grande do Norte, is analyzed as a tool for evaluating the institutional performance of executive branch agencies. The research adopts a mixed-methods approach, combining qualitative and quantitative techniques such as correlation, regression, and clustering, alongside the use of Power BI and Google Colab. Structured around three dimensions — Transparency, Budgetary, and Accountability — the iPC identifies significant disparities across thematic areas, fostering a culture of monitoring, promoting continuous improvement, and strengthening governance, integrity, and transparency practices in public administration.
